What Charging Practices Maximize Battery Lifespan?
Use a smart charger with automatic voltage detection (12V for series setups). Avoid discharging below 50% (≈6.32V per cell). Charge within 24 hours post-use to prevent sulfation. Equalize monthly: apply controlled overcharge (15.5V for 2-4 hours) to balance cells. Ambient temps above 110°F reduce efficiency—store in shaded, ventilated areas.
Which Golf Cart Models Are Compatible?
Interstate 6V batteries fit Club Car Precedent (48V systems: 8x6V), E-Z-GO TXT (36V: 6x6V), and Yamaha Drive2. Terminal configurations (SAE vs. automotive) vary by model—measure compartment dimensions (typical 10.25”L x 7.25”W x 10.9”H) and verify polarity alignment. Custom cables may be needed for aftermarket upgrades.
Why Does Maintenance Impact Warranty Claims?
Interstate’s 12-24 month pro-rated warranty requires proof of proper watering (distilled only), voltage logs, and no signs of terminal corrosion. Neglecting electrolyte levels voids coverage—check monthly, refilling to 1/8” below fill wells. Case cracks from over-tightening mounts also invalidate guarantees.
How to Recycle Interstate Batteries Responsibly?
98% of lead-acid components are recyclable. Interstate partners with 15,000+ retailers for EPA-compliant drop-offs. Core charges ($18-$25 per battery) incentivize returns. Never landfill—lead toxicity risks $10k+ fines under RCRA. Recycling recovers 15 lbs lead, 1 gal sulfuric acid, and 2 lbs polypropylene per unit.

FAQs
- How often should I water my Interstate 6V battery?
- Check monthly; refill with distilled water post-charging to avoid overflow. Maintain levels 1/8” above plates.
- Can I mix old and new batteries in my cart?
- No—voltage variances strain newer units. Always replace all batteries in a series simultaneously.
- What’s the ideal storage voltage?
- Store at 6.37V (50% charge) in cool (50-70°F), dry areas. Use maintenance chargers if inactive over 30 days.
